Celebrate Cinco de Mayo with these specials

Want to make Cinco de Mayo extra special? Here are five of our top picks for where to celebrate:

At China Poblano at The Cosmopolitan of Las Vegas (3708 Las Vegas Blvd. South; 877-893-2003 or www.cosmopolitanlasvegas.com), chef Jose Andres has planned food specials to be served May 1-5. They are: Ceviche de Peje-Sol, $14; Taco de Camarones Enchipotlada, $8; Empanadas de Pescado, $15; Costilla de Res, $16; and house-made paletas, $6. Cocktail specials are Tequila Stinger, $16; Cielo Rojo, $16; Michelada Millonario, $13; and Michelada con Cerveza Obscura, $12. Share the Cinco de Mayo password and you can get a free paleta.

The Commissary Latin Kitchen at the Downtown Grand (206 N. Third St.; 702-719-5311 or www.richardsandoval.com) is offering all-you-can-eat tacos and unlimited tequila drinks for $15 per person, and $4 tequila shots or drinks and $2 tacos beginning at 11 a.m. May 5. Beginning at 4 p.m., premium tequila will be $4, and there will be a live mariachi band from 6 to 9 p.m.

Go to Hecho en Vegas at the MGM Grand (3799 Las Vegas Blvd. South; 702-891-3200 or www.mgmgrand.com) at 2 p.m. May 5 for interactive demonstrations followed by a menu of Chiles en Nogada, Lamb Barbacoa Bandera and Bandera Bomba, with tequila pairings, for $75.

Rumor has it that the margarita was created at the original Ensenada location of Hussong’s Cantina (The Shoppes at Mandalay Place, 3950 Las Vegas Blvd. South; 702-632-6450 or www.hussongslasvegas.com), so celebrate with $36 Corona Light beer towers and $20 buckets of Corona through May 5. On May 5, specials include $5 Puebla-style guacamole and $5 Sauza Bandera shots, and Pee Wee Herman will lead the Tequila Dance at 7 p.m.

At Tacos & Tequila at the Luxor (3900 Las Vegas Blvd. South; 702-262-5225 or www.luxor.com), specials from 6 to 9 p.m. on May 5 will include Fries de Mayo with carne asada, carnitas and chicken; Great Balls of Fire, Mexican meatballs on a skewer; Los Tres Amigos, poblano, chicken and barbacoa taquitos; and Hottie Tamalie!, chicken, vegetable and barbacoa tamales, $10 each. El Jimador frozen margaritas, El Jimador tequila shots and Dos Equis beer bottles will be $5 and a shot of El Jimador tequila and bottle of Dos Equis beer $10.
